I'm not easterly sure what you're doing there, like those checkboxes you mention.

 

For the first issue, you're probably having a securom problem

- remove any disk imaging software you may have

- reinstall the vc++ libraries from the game disk

- use the securom diagnostics tool https://support.securom.com/analysis.php

 

About those freezes, try lowering the settings. Do you have a screenshot for those white blocks?

 

If the game minimizes on it's own, it's plausible you have some software in the background taking focus, you'll want to shut it down prior to running the game.

1. it's nice to see people using buying games, but nevertheless, programs like daemon tools cause conflicts with Securom

2. visual basic libraries, a file called vc_setup.exe should be on the game disk, in the redistributable folder. Secruom needs those libraries to work properly

3. you use the latest game version?

4. stuttering is what you experience and it usually isn't that easy to get rid off. You can try disabling the windows even log, that can help sometimes.
